Why the pay is high?

1. Remote and Isolated Location
- Oil rigs are often hundreds of miles offshore. Workers can’t just “pop home” at the end of a shift.
- This isolation requires higher pay to make the job attractive to qualified workers.

2. Demanding Skill Sets
- Many positions require technical expertise (engineers, drill operators, safety officers).
- High-stakes work with dangerous equipment justifies premium pay.

3. Long Hours in Harsh Conditions
- Typical rotations are 2–4 weeks on, followed by a week or more off.
- Shifts are long, sometimes 12 hours a day, often 7 days a week.
- The high pay compensates for these grueling schedules.

4. High Risk
- Oil rigs are hazardous: heavy machinery, high-pressure systems, exposure to chemicals, risk of fires, and potential for accidents in extreme weather.
- Companies offer hazard pay to attract workers willing to take on these risks.

5. Physical and Mental Stress
- Jobs can be physically demanding: lifting, climbing ladders, standing for hours, and working in confined spaces.
- Mental stress comes from isolation, monotony, and being away from family for weeks.

6. Onboard Living Trade-offs
- Workers live in shared, cramped quarters. Privacy is minimal.
- Meals are provided, but dietary options may be limited.
- Entertainment is restricted (though some rigs have gyms, TV, and internet).

Safer, less uncomfortable jobs, requiring similar skills and that make (almost) the same money are:
- Subsea / Offshore Engineering (onshore-based roles)
- Industrial / Plant Maintenance Engineer (oil, chemical, or power plants)
- Pipeline or Subsea Infrastructure Inspector / Engineer
- Robotics / Automation Technician in Oil & Gas or Manufacturing
- High-Pressure Equipment / Turbine Engineer (if you don't fear heights)

Let me act as a devil’s advocate.
Actual Federal income Tax Rate: The 24% withholding is an upfront payment. Your final tax is determined by your total taxable income (winnings plus salary, etc.) and your tax bracket, which can be as high as 37%. You may owe more when you file your tax return if your tax bracket is higher than 24%

Also,

Advertised Jackpot (Annuity Value): The large number you see advertised is the total amount the winner would receive over approximately 30 annual payments, which increase each year. This total is larger because it includes the interest earned from the lottery investing the money over those three decades.
Lump Sum (Cash Value): If you choose the "full payout" (lump sum) option, you receive the AVAILABLE CASH PRIZE immediately. This is the amount of money the lottery would have had to invest to fund the 30-year annuity, so it is naturally a much lower amount (often 40% to 50% less than the advertised jackpot) even BEFORE any taxes are considered.

And, last but not least, there wouldn’t be any lottery games if the original voter approval had not been tied to using a portion to fund education or other benefits.

Melt Value: The primary value comes from the silver content, also known as "junk silver" value. As of December 2025, the melt value for a single 1964 half dollar is around $24.06. For 40 coins, the total melt value is approximately $962.40.
--------------------------------------- added after 10 hours

1964 and older coins have 90% silver and 1965-1968 have 70% silver. 69- present are only worth face value, so if you have 40 pre 1964 fifty cent pieces you can get around $950.00 melt value and half that for 65-68 half dollars. All assorted pre1964 coins can be mixed in a one lb bag to receive 950. Dollars
